Properties

$_propDict

$_propDict : \Microsoft\Graph\Model\array(string

The array of properties available to the model

Type

\Microsoft\Graph\Model\array(string — => string)

Methods

__construct()

__construct(array  $propDict = array()) 

Construct a new DriveItem

Parameters

array $propDict

A list of properties to set

getProperties()

getProperties() : array

Gets the property dictionary of the DriveItem

Returns

array —

The list of properties

setCreatedBy()

setCreatedBy(string  $val) : null

Sets the createdBy

Parameters

string $val

The createdBy

Returns

null

getCreatedDateTime()

getCreatedDateTime() : \Microsoft\Graph\Model\datetime

Gets the createdDateTime

Returns

\Microsoft\Graph\Model\datetime —

The createdDateTime

setCreatedDateTime()

setCreatedDateTime(\Microsoft\Graph\Model\datetime  $val) : null

Sets the createdDateTime

Parameters

\Microsoft\Graph\Model\datetime $val

The createdDateTime

Returns

null

getDescription()

getDescription() : string

Gets the description

Returns

string —

The description

setDescription()

setDescription(string  $val) : null

Sets the description

Parameters

string $val

The description

Returns

null

getETag()

getETag() : string

Gets the eTag

Returns

string —

The eTag

setETag()

setETag(string  $val) : null

Sets the eTag

Parameters

string $val

The eTag

Returns

null

setLastModifiedBy()

setLastModifiedBy(string  $val) : null

Sets the lastModifiedBy

Parameters

string $val

The lastModifiedBy

Returns

null

getLastModifiedDateTime()

getLastModifiedDateTime() : \Microsoft\Graph\Model\datetime

Gets the lastModifiedDateTime

Returns

\Microsoft\Graph\Model\datetime —

The lastModifiedDateTime

setLastModifiedDateTime()

setLastModifiedDateTime(\Microsoft\Graph\Model\datetime  $val) : null

Sets the lastModifiedDateTime

Parameters

\Microsoft\Graph\Model\datetime $val

The lastModifiedDateTime

Returns

null

getName()

getName() : string

Gets the name

Returns

string —

The name

setName()

setName(string  $val) : null

Sets the name

Parameters

string $val

The name

Returns

null

getWebUrl()

getWebUrl() : string

Gets the webUrl

Returns

string —

The webUrl

setWebUrl()

setWebUrl(string  $val) : null

Sets the webUrl

Parameters

string $val

The webUrl

Returns

null

setAudio()

setAudio(string  $val) : null

Sets the audio

Parameters

string $val

The audio

Returns

null

getCTag()

getCTag() : string

Gets the cTag

Returns

string —

The cTag

setCTag()

setCTag(string  $val) : null

Sets the cTag

Parameters

string $val

The cTag

Returns

null

setDeleted()

setDeleted(string  $val) : null

Sets the deleted

Parameters

string $val

The deleted

Returns

null

setFile()

setFile(string  $val) : null

Sets the file

Parameters

string $val

The file

Returns

null

setFileSystemInfo()

setFileSystemInfo(string  $val) : null

Sets the fileSystemInfo

Parameters

string $val

The fileSystemInfo

Returns

null

setFolder()

setFolder(string  $val) : null

Sets the folder

Parameters

string $val

The folder

Returns

null

setImage()

setImage(string  $val) : null

Sets the image

Parameters

string $val

The image

Returns

null

setLocation()

setLocation(string  $val) : null

Sets the location

Parameters

string $val

The location

Returns

null

setPackage()

setPackage(string  $val) : null

Sets the package

Parameters

string $val

The package

Returns

null

setParentReference()

setParentReference(string  $val) : null

Sets the parentReference

Parameters

string $val

The parentReference

Returns

null

setPhoto()

setPhoto(string  $val) : null

Sets the photo

Parameters

string $val

The photo

Returns

null

setRemoteItem()

setRemoteItem(string  $val) : null

Sets the remoteItem

Parameters

string $val

The remoteItem

Returns

null

setRoot()

setRoot(string  $val) : null

Sets the root

Parameters

string $val

The root

Returns

null

setSearchResult()

setSearchResult(string  $val) : null

Sets the searchResult

Parameters

string $val

The searchResult

Returns

null

setShared()

setShared(string  $val) : null

Sets the shared

Parameters

string $val

The shared

Returns

null

setSharepointIds()

setSharepointIds(string  $val) : null

Sets the sharepointIds

Parameters

string $val

The sharepointIds

Returns

null

getSize()

getSize() : integer

Gets the size

Returns

integer —

The size

setSize()

setSize(integer  $val) : null

Sets the size

Parameters

integer $val

The size

Returns

null

setSpecialFolder()

setSpecialFolder(string  $val) : null

Sets the specialFolder

Parameters

string $val

The specialFolder

Returns

null

setVideo()

setVideo(string  $val) : null

Sets the video

Parameters

string $val

The video

Returns

null

getWebDavUrl()

getWebDavUrl() : string

Gets the webDavUrl

Returns

string —

The webDavUrl

setWebDavUrl()

setWebDavUrl(string  $val) : null

Sets the webDavUrl

Parameters

string $val

The webDavUrl

Returns

null

getCreatedByUser()

getCreatedByUser() : \Microsoft\Graph\Model\User

Gets the createdByUser

Returns

\Microsoft\Graph\Model\User

The createdByUser

setCreatedByUser()

setCreatedByUser(string  $val) : null

Sets the createdByUser

Parameters

string $val

The createdByUser

Returns

null

setWorkbook()

setWorkbook(string  $val) : null

Sets the workbook

Parameters

string $val

The workbook

Returns

null

getLastModifiedByUser()

getLastModifiedByUser() : \Microsoft\Graph\Model\User

Gets the lastModifiedByUser

Returns

\Microsoft\Graph\Model\User

The lastModifiedByUser

setLastModifiedByUser()

setLastModifiedByUser(string  $val) : null

Sets the lastModifiedByUser

Parameters

string $val

The lastModifiedByUser

Returns

null

getChildren()

getChildren() : \Microsoft\Graph\Model\ChildrenCollectionPage

Gets the children

Returns

\Microsoft\Graph\Model\ChildrenCollectionPage —

The children

getPermissions()

getPermissions() : \Microsoft\Graph\Model\PermissionsCollectionPage

Gets the permissions

Returns

\Microsoft\Graph\Model\PermissionsCollectionPage —

The permissions

getThumbnails()

getThumbnails() : \Microsoft\Graph\Model\ThumbnailsCollectionPage

Gets the thumbnails

Returns

\Microsoft\Graph\Model\ThumbnailsCollectionPage —

The thumbnails